Each kitten can have its own personality that differs from the "standard" for the breed. In general I find male cats to be more "cuddly" than females but there are exceptions to that rule. Also kittens can have drastic changes in their personality as they grow into adults. So you may look at adult cats for adoption as their personalities are more set. The other consideration is that in a shelter setting it is hard to really judge a cat's personality since there can be strange noises, smells, environment. At the end of the day if this kitten is really "speaking" to you it could be she is meant for you and you can help mold her personality through lots of interaction and play.
